It includes $4.5 billion for the Department of Health and Human Services to work to contain the outbreak in the U.S., $1 billion to develop and manufacture a vaccine, $1 billion to help other countries battle the coronavirus, and $2 billion to reimburse states for costs incurred in tackling the outbreak. coronavirus medikament - The airline is also offering a one-way flight from Shanghai to Harbin — a 994-mile trip — for 69 yuan, or $9.80. Meanwhile, on Shenzhen Airlines, travelers can buy a 100 yuan ($14) ticket from Shenzhen to Chongqing — a 621-mile journey, the outlet reported. CLICK HERE TO GET THE FOX NEWS APP “Considering lower average costs of operating in mainland China, carriers could potentially offer deeper discounts while making slim profits or just breaking even,” Luya You, an aviation analyst with Bank of Communication International, told the English-language newspaper.
